Full‑time permanent Primary (Co‑Teaching) Classroom Teacher position, Larkhall Academy, St. John’s. Duties to commence September 8, 2026.
As the successful candidate, you are committed to furthering the goals for student success in an inclusive, safe and caring environment. You subscribe to a student‑first philosophy in your practice and believe that collaboration is key for your growth as an educator.
If selected for an interview, candidates should be prepared to speak about their experience and demonstrated competencies in relation to the 8 Standards of Practice for Classroom Teachers (outlined below).
Know learners and how they learn
Know the content and teaching strategies
Ability to plan and implement effective, responsive teaching and learning
Ability to assess, provide feedback, and report on student learning
Ability to create and maintain supportive, safe, and inclusive environments
Ability to engage collaboratively with families and the school community
Demonstrates a growth mindset
Demonstrates professionalism
Additional information regarding these standards can be found at: 8 Standards of Practice for Classroom Teachers.
